Characterisation of the Electricity Use in European Union and the Savings Potential in 2010 characterised the electricity used in the industrial and tertiary sectors and the electricity consumption associated with the different types of electric motors systems in the Member States of the European Union, as well as estimated future evolution until 2010. Electric Variable Speed Drives Development (1–300 kW) and Some Impacts on Energy Savingly dominating technology, which are called the classic EVSD topology. The typical Energy Saving potential and some typical Converter and Motor efficiencies are given and discussed. The Market situation for EVSD’s is commented.
